About the GeForce GT 650M

The GeForce GT 650M is an entry-level laptop GPU from NVIDIA, part of the Kepler architecture that launched in early 2012. Positioned as a budget-friendly option for mobile gaming, it features 2 GB of VRAM and a G3D benchmark score of 1,182, making it suitable for casual gamers looking for decent performance in older titles. In the context of its generation and tier, the GT 650M serves well for users not demanding top-tier graphical fidelity but still wanting a smooth gaming experience.

When it comes to gaming performance, the GeForce GT 650M shines at 1080p resolution, often reaching around 30-60 FPS in many popular games. Titles like "League of Legends" and "Dota 2" are perfect examples where you can expect solid performance at medium to high settings. Even more demanding games like "Skyrim" can be played with acceptable frames, particularly if settings are tweaked. While DLSS is not available on this older model, enabling lower settings can help in maintaining smoother FPS for casual gaming experiences.

This GPU is ideal for budget-conscious gamers who are looking to play less demanding or older games without investing in high-end hardware. However, by 2026, alternatives such as the GTX 1650 or AMD’s RX 5500M may provide a more future-proof option at a minimal price increase. For those prioritizing value and gaming on older titles or indie games, the GeForce GT 650M remains a reasonable choice, especially if you can find it at a low price.
